在本文中,我们将探讨如何在 Python 中将 OBJ 转换为 FBX。这篇博文对于自动化导出大量文件的过程很有用。我们将讨论转换过程中涉及的步骤以及使过程尽可能顺利的配置。按照本文,您可以创建一个转换器,将 3D OBJ 文件导出为 Python 中的 FBX 格式。
Python OBJ 到 FBX 转换器——免费下载
Aspose.3D for Python via .NET 支持在您的应用程序中使用许多 3D 文件格式。您可以使用下面的 pip 命令下载 package 或从 PyPI 安装它:
pip install aspose-3d
如何将 OBJ 格式转换为 FBX 格式
您可以通过以下步骤将 OBJ 文件转换为 FBX 格式:
- 加载源 OBJ 文件。
- 设置 FBX 文件的保存选项。
- 将 OBJ 文件导出为 FBX 格式。
以下部分将进一步阐述如何使用 Python 将 OBJ 文件转换为 FBX 格式。
使用 Python 将 OBJ 转换为 FBX
您可以按照以下步骤将 OBJ 文件转换为 FBX 格式:
- 首先,使用 Scene.fromfile() 方法加载源 OBJ 文件。
- 接下来,初始化 FbxSaveOptions 类的一个对象。
- 调用 save() 方法渲染输出 FBX 文件。
下面的代码片段显示了如何使用 Python 将 OBJ 转换为 FBX。
# Load input OBJ file with Scene class
scene = Scene.from_file("sample.obj");
# Initialize FbxSaveOptions class object
fbxSaveOptions = FbxSaveOptions(FileFormat.FBX7500ASCII);
# Convert OBJ to FBX file
scene.save("sample.fbx", fbxSaveOptions);
获得免费的临时许可证
您可以申请 免费临时许可证 来评估 API,而没有任何评估限制。
在线试用
以下实用程序基于此 API,可以测试其性能或功能:
https://products.aspose.app/3d/conversion/obj-to-fbx
结论
本文介绍了如何在 Python 中将 OBJ 转换为 FBX。但是,您可以通过访问 文档 通过 .NET API 进一步探索 Aspose.3D for Python。如有任何疑问,请写信给我们 免费支持论坛。